The Infrastructure Team
Examples of key problems the team is working on
  • Bring gigawatts of accelerators from first power-on to production. Facility availability to ready-for-service across thousands of racks per site, with a new data hall landing every few weeks.
  • Make rack qualification faster than the fleet grows. Firmware baselines, burn-in, and cluster validation proven on every rack before a customer workload touches it, at a pace that never becomes the critical path.
  • Scale by tooling, not headcount. Deployed megawatts grow severalfold next year while the team stays near-flat, because anything done twice by hand becomes software.
Role Scope
  • Own compute turn-up from facility availability to ready-for-service: the stretch after the network hands off and before customers run workloads.
  • Qualify racks at scale: establish firmware baselines, configure BMC and BIOS, run burn-in, and validate at node and cluster level across hundreds of racks per site on GPU and custom accelerator platforms.
  • Drive qualification through the base-management Kubernetes platform and provisioning stack (discovery, imaging, firmware updates, shared services), burning down qual queues with tooling rather than manual runs.
  • Triage hardware failures found in qualification: isolate to component, drive RMA and vendor escalation, and feed failure patterns back into the qual gates.
  • Run turn-up remotely by default, with on-site pulses of roughly a week per data hall as new halls reach facility availability, plus occasional overlapping-site weeks.
  • Partner with network deployment, ICT, data center operations, and hardware teams during turn-up windows, and support incident response on freshly-live capacity.
